Dropshipping databases such as Worldwide Brands help you avoid bad vendors. Asking probing questions can help you evaluate suppliers. Expectations should be met when suppliers respond. Ask them questions about their return policy, warranty periods, customisation, pricing, and other details.

Dropshipping comes with the drawback of making customers unhappy. It is possible for vendors to make mistakes when fulfilling orders. This can be frustrating and can even lead to a loss of business. You should research all dropshippers before deciding on one.

Dropshipping also has the advantage of not having to keep inventory. You can ship customers orders to third-party dropship suppliers and only process them. This allows for you to evaluate new products before you invest in inventory. You can also offer your customers more options. This will enable you to create a better product range and encourage customers spend more with you.


Dropshipping has the downside that you lose control of your supply chain. Dropshipping partners are responsible for everything, including packaging, warehouse, delivery, and customer services. If your dropshipping partner fails to do a good job, customers will be forced to buy it elsewhere.

It is important to read the terms and conditions before signing up for an affiliate program. Affiliate programs often prohibit pay-per-click ads. You should also be aware of the timeframe for promoting affiliate links. Many affiliate programs prohibit the use or promotion of the company's names in ads. This can pose a serious problem if not taken care of.
